Throwback movies. This summer Cinema Akil at Alserkal Avenue invites you to travel through time with their biggest classics programme yet! From sci-fi, horror, mafia, romance, there will be a whole host of movies from the ‘60s through to the ‘90s. At 4pm on Saturday you can catch Paris Belongs To Us (1961), which follows a young literature student who befriends the members of a loose-knit group of twentysomethings in Paris suffused with a lingering post–World War II disillusionment.

Catch the Lions. There’s a new player in town meaning more can watch sport at home. Starzplay will exclusively stream the upcoming Lions Rugby Tour in the region via its new add on channel ‘Premier Sports’. Rugby’s most famous touring team – the British & Irish Lions - will be heading this year to South Africa and will face the world champions to play an incredible eight-match tour. The British & Irish Lions will play three Test matches against South Africa as well as five other matches. Games begin July 3 and run until August 7.
